出 处:《低温与超导》2009年第3期36-39,共4页Cryogenics and Superconductivity
基 金:国家自然科学基金项目(50676041)资助
摘 要:介绍了热管废热溴化锂制冷机的工作原理,讨论了驱动热源温度对机组各个发生器制冷量的影响。在给定的温度区间内通过理论计算和分析,得到了高压发生器、低压发生器a和b的制冷量以及它们与总制冷量的比值分别随着烟气进口、中间和出口温度变化的曲线图。论文中还给出最佳中间温度区间,为今后的实验论证提供了理论依据。In this paper working principle of waste heat LiBr - H2O absorption chiller with heat pipe was introduced anti effect of temperature of driving heat source on refrigerating capacity of every generator of units was discussed. In order to find the curve that cooling capacity of the high pressure generator, the low pressure generator a, b and the ratio of them and the total cool- ing capacity change with the inlet temperature, the middle temperature and the outlet temperature of the gas, the theoretical calculation and the analysis were given in a given temperature range. The optimal intermediate temperature was also given. This can provide theoretical evidence for the future experiment argumentation.
